The New Mendicants will be supported by London based, Edinburgh born Blue Rose Code aka singer/songwriter Ross Wilson. He will bring his highly-acclaimed folk/roots, Caledonian Soul sound to Colston Hall and will perfrom tracks from his highly anticipated debut album, 'North Ten' which was released via Reveal Records (Home of Simon Felice, Joan As Police Woman, Roddy Woomble, LAU).
Raised in a council high rise by his grandmother on the east side on Edinburgh, Wilson skipped school to endlessly listen to his records (Motown, Chet Baker, John Coltrane and the unholy trinity of Van Morrison, John Martyn and Tom Waits). Through 2009 and 2010 Blue Rose Code shared the stage with many celebrated writers including Bert Jansch, Kris Drever, King Creosote, John Renbourn and James Yorkston.
After a period out of the limelight, his return to the UK has enjoyed a steady snowballing of new fans and momentum.
